Abstract

Provided is drum type washing machine, comprising a housing, a water drum, a rotary drum, a motor, a water route, and a nozzle, wherein the water drum comprises a water drum opening portion which is formed inside the housing and arranged at one front side of the housing; the rotary drum is provided with a rotary drum opening portion at one front side of the housing; the water route leads the water into the interior of the water drum; and the nozzle is communicated with the water route. The water drum is provided with a ring-shaped guide board and a water taking opening portion, wherein the ring-shaped guide board is provided with a bending portion which, arranged upon the inner wall surface of the water drum opening portion, bends in the back and forth direction of the housing; and the water taking opening portion extends in the circumferential direction at the upper portion of the front of the water drum and appears in a rectangular shape and is communicated with the nozzle. The nozzle is provided with a jet which sprays water toward the interior of the water drum, extends in circumferential direction of the water drum, and appears in a rectangular shape. A curved portion is provided upon the inner surface of the portion of the jet and bends in the circumferential direction of the water drum. The water provided by the water route sequentially flows through the curve portion and the bending portion and is sprayed into the rotary drum.
